Happy Birthday Fireside21!

October 15th, 2009 | Filed under: Fireside21 News | Posted by Ken

Fireside21 was born a year ago today. It was a redefining moment for our company, charting a new course as a web-based software provider.

It’s a nice time to reflect upon our mission: to help legislators build close relationships with constituents using the latest technologies and strategies. This year, more than ever, we’ve been focused on that goal with the launch of our innovative Constituent Relationship Management (CRM) tools.

I’m happy to report that we’re on track for our best year ever. That includes going back to our time as a division of Adfero Group.
